Customers are increasingly looking for quality in both the coffee and coffee machine markets
The demand for quality products is also increasingly characteristic of the coffee machine market, the changes in the coffee market worth about 70 billion HUF annually are followed by asset purchase trends according to the experience of Costa Coffee and eMAG.
According to the data, the coffee brand, since its launch in May last year, has achieved a 20 percent share in the premium segment. This has also been helped by the ever-increasing demand for quality coffees, as people increasingly expect experiences from coffee as well. (MTI)
